Signal Lost just means that marine is outright dead I think, from either taking a lethal injury in combat or from being successfully carried off to the hive by the aliens; I don't think they can be rescued in the later case but I'm not certain. It's random chance but marines seem to have a variety of different states they can end up in from taking damage.
I think what happens is when a marine takes a Wound from being at 2 health (or 1 from a skill) they have a chance to get an arm or leg injury, or to get knocked unconscious in 1 of 2 states, unless I'm wrong and the downed states are alternative chances to outright death and not the Wound, like XCOM.
Either way, sometimes all a downed marine needs to get up is to spend medical supplies on them in the field, but sometimes they get knocked into a coma and are down for the entire mission and have to be extracted unless you have a Medic, who can revive them in the field with a certain class upgrade.
Marines who get knocked unconscious seem to be spared by the aliens, which ironically seems to give them better survivability than marines who take different Wound injuries and usually die outright shortly after. I'd assume this initiates a change in their behavior where they'd try to grab them and pull them to the hive but I'm pretty sure I've seen some start pulling fully conscious marines too.
I'm not certain how this alien behavior works but it stands to reason it might have some nuance to it, like the number of aliens overwhelming the group, the types of alien involved, etc. If I can't carry a comatose marine at the moment for some reason I set up a sentry gun over his body, which seems to be enough to kill any drone or runner entering the area.
